Bug 124707 - Shapes with polar handle in pptx are broken when document is saved in ODF format.
Summary: Shapes with polar handle in pptx are broken when document is saved in ODF for...
Status: RESOLVED WORKSFORME
Alias: None
Product: LibreOffice
Classification: Unclassified
Component: Impress (show other bugs)
Version:
(earliest affected)
4.0.1.2 release
Hardware: x86-64 (AMD64) All
: medium normal
Assignee: Not Assigned
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: PPTX-Shapes
  Show dependency treegraph
 
Reported: 2019-04-12 17:43 UTC by Regina Henschel
Modified: 2023-01-16 14:16 UTC (History)
2 users (show)

See Also:
Crash report or crash signature:


Attachments
File with donut, noSmoking, blockArc and circularArrow shape (20.25 KB, application/vnd.openxmlformats-officedocument.presentationml.presentation)
2019-04-12 17:43 UTC, Regina Henschel
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Regina Henschel 2019-04-12 17:43:18 UTC
Created attachment 150718 [details]
File with donut, noSmoking, blockArc and circularArrow shape

Open attached file.
Verify, that the handles are moveable and change the shape outline. (Some handles react wrongly, but that is a different issue, which I currently working on.)
Save the file to odp-format.
Open the saved file.
Error: The handles are no longer moveable.

The error is a save error. The saved odp-document misses the draw:handle-polar attribute.

I see the error in Version: Version 4.0.1.2 (Build ID: 84102822e3d61eb989ddd325abf1ac077904985)

It is not inherit from OOo, that had other errors. And it is no regression, LO 3.5.4 does not show the shapes at all.
Comment 1 raal 2019-04-13 05:58:27 UTC
Confirm with Version: 6.3.0.0.alpha0+
Build ID: 31ac398cfa30694b18240d31df17a58d699b5bf6
CPU threads: 4; OS: Linux 4.15; UI render: default; VCL: gtk3;
Comment 2 QA Administrators 2023-01-16 03:21:42 UTC Comment hidden (obsolete)
Comment 3 Regina Henschel 2023-01-16 14:16:38 UTC
The handle movement is OK in Version: 7.6.0.0.alpha0+ (X86_64) / LibreOffice Community
Build ID: 12e8d57e791bb1befc0716d4d02af7d1d1ccb4ae
CPU threads: 8; OS: Windows 10.0 Build 19045; UI render: Skia/Raster; VCL: win
Locale: de-DE (en_US); UI: en-US
Calc: CL threaded